Ard Biesheuvel [Mon, 3 Jul 2017 13:46:18 +0000 (14:46 +0100)]
ArmVirtPkg: switch to generic ResetSystemRuntimeDxe
For obscure reasons, ARM platforms use a different implementation of
the ResetSystem() runtime service call than other platforms. So let's
switch all ArmVirtPkg platforms to the generic version instead.
Given that all platforms use an implementation of EfiResetSystemLib [as
consumed by the ResetRuntimeDxe in EmbeddedPkg that we are replacing]
which is unlikely to be depended upon by out of tree platforms, let's
simply modify this library into an implementation of ResetSystemLib
instead [which is what the generic driver in MdeModulePkg consumes]
This does mean we need to update all clients at the same time, which
is why all changes are part of the same patch.
As before, warm reset and platform specific reset are mapped onto
cold reset (which is the only thing PSCI implements, at least the
version we depend on). The new library function EnterS3WithImmediateWake()
is left unimplemented, as permitted by the ResetSystemLib library class.

Ard Biesheuvel [Fri, 23 Jun 2017 14:50:53 +0000 (14:50 +0000)]
MdeModulePkg/AtaAtapiPassThru: relax PHY detect timeout
The SATA spec mandates that link detection by the PHY completes within
10 ms after receiving a reset signal. However, there is no obligation
to uphold this requirement at the driver end as strictly as we do, and
as it turns out, some combinations of host and device (e.g., Samsung
850 EVO connected to a LeMaker Cello) are only borderline compliant,
which means the device is not detected reliably.
So let's allow for a bit of margin, and increase the PHY detect timeout
value to 15 ms.

Ard Biesheuvel [Tue, 20 Jun 2017 18:43:54 +0000 (20:43 +0200)]
BaseTools/tools_def: AARCH64: disable LTO type mismatch warnings
On AARCH64, any code that may execute with the MMU off needs to be built
with -mstrict-align, given that unaligned accesses are not allowed unless
the MMU is enabled. This does not only affect SEC and PEI modules, but
also static libraries of the BASE type, which may be linked into such
modules, as well as into modules of other types. As it turns out, the
presence of -mstrict-align is reflected in the internal representations
of the types defined in those libraries.
When -fstrict-aliasing is passed to GCC, it assumes that pointers to
objects of different types cannot refer to the same memory location, and
attempts to exploit this fact when optimizing the code. Since such
assumptions are only valid under very strict conditions which are not
guaranteed to be met in EDK2, we disable this optimization by passing
-fno-strict-aliasing by default. [*]
When LTO is in effect, this applies equally to the code generation that
may occur at link time, which is why the linker warns about unexpected
differences in type definitions between the intermediate representations
that are present in the object files being linked. This may result in
warnings such as the one below, even if -fno-strict-aliasing is used:
MdePkg/Include/Library/BaseLib.h:1712:1:
warning: type of 'StrToGuid' does not match original declaration
[-Wlto-type-mismatch]
StrToGuid (
^
MdePkg/Library/BaseLib/SafeString.c:1506:1:
note: 'StrToGuid' was previously declared here
StrToGuid (
^
MdePkg/Library/BaseLib/SafeString.c:1506:1:
note: code may be misoptimized unless -fno-strict-aliasing is used
This warning is inadvertently triggered when linking BASE libraries built
with -mstrict-align into modules of types other than SEC or PEI, since the
types are subtly different, even though the use of code that maintains
strict alignment in a module that does not care about this is unlikely to
cause problems. And even if it did, it would still only affect code built
with -fstrict-aliasing enabled, which we disable unconditionally. So let's
just silence the warning by passing -Wno-lto-type-mismatch.
[*] Leif adds: "-fstrict-aliasing is GCC default, because it is a
restriction in the C language. Because it's a bit non-obvious, things
can go hilariously wrong in very non-obvious ways, and the potential
optimization gains are unlikely to be generally relevant,
-fno-strict-aliasing is a sensible thing to always have set (like we
do)."

Shi, Steven [Sat, 20 May 2017 09:05:17 +0000 (17:05 +0800)]
MdeModulePkg: Fix use-after-free error in InstallConfigurationTable()
REF: https://bugzilla.tianocore.org/show_bug.cgi?id=601
When installing configuration table and the original
gDxeCoreST->ConfigurationTable[] buffer happen to be not big enough to
add a new table, the CoreInstallConfigurationTable() enter the branch
of line 113 in InstallConfigurationTable.c to free the old
gDxeCoreST->ConfigurationTable[] buffer and allocate a new bigger one.
The problem happens at line 139 CoreFreePool(), which is to free the
old gDxeCoreST->ConfigurationTable[] buffer. The CoreFreePool()'s
behavior is to free the buffer firstly, then call the
InstallMemoryAttributesTableOnMemoryAllocation (PoolType) to update
the EfiRuntimeServices type memory info, the
CoreInstallConfigurationTable() will be re-entered by CoreFreePool()
in its calling stack, then use-after-free read error will happen at
line 59 of InstallConfigurationTable.c and use-after-free write error
will happen at line 151 and 152 of InstallConfigurationTable.c.
The patch is to update System table to the new table pointer before
calling CoreFreePool() to free the old table.
The case above is in DxeCore, but not in PiSmmCore.
The change in PiSmmCore is to be consistent with DxeCore.

Laszlo Ersek [Sat, 3 Jun 2017 14:11:08 +0000 (16:11 +0200)]
OvmfPkg/AcpiPlatformDxe: alloc blobs from 64-bit space unless restricted
... by narrower than 8-byte ADD_POINTER references.
Introduce the CollectAllocationsRestrictedTo32Bit() function, which
iterates over the linker/loader script, and collects the names of the
fw_cfg blobs that are referenced by QEMU_LOADER_ADD_POINTER.PointeeFile
fields, such that QEMU_LOADER_ADD_POINTER.PointerSize is less than 8. This
means that the pointee blob's address will have to be patched into a
narrower-than-8 byte pointer field, hence the pointee blob must not be
allocated from 64-bit address space.
In ProcessCmdAllocate(), consult these restrictions when setting the
maximum address for gBS->AllocatePages(). The default is now MAX_UINT64,
unless restricted like described above to the pre-patch MAX_UINT32 limit.
In combination with Ard's QEMU commit
cb51ac2ffe36 ("hw/arm/virt: generate
64-bit addressable ACPI objects", 2017-04-10), this patch enables
OvmfPkg/AcpiPlatformDxe to work entirely above the 4GB mark.
(An upcoming / planned aarch64 QEMU machine type will have no RAM under
4GB at all. Plus, moving the allocations higher is beneficial to the
current "virt" machine type as well; in Ard's words: "having all firmware
allocations inside the same 1 GB (or 512 MB for 64k pages) frame reduces
the TLB footprint".)
